Moving Supplies
When taking on the task of moving, packing, loading, and unpacking is part of the job that can be time consuming as well as stressful. Whether you are using a moving company or self moving, having to locate moving supplies can also add to the tension. You cannot assume that what you have available in your house is going to get the job done. While your first notion is to use the old boxes, bags, or whatever else deemed packable material to put your household goods in, it might not be a guarantee that they will be protected. The other option is to purchase special packing material from a moving company or opt to seek a company that will offer free moving supplies.
While most moving companies and truck rental services charge for their moving supplies, there are a few others who make their services more attractive by offering the supplies free. Sometimes it is just a matter of asking your local movers for free boxes before you book their services. If they feel that giving the free moving supplies away will gain a customer, then most likely it will not be a problem. These free items can be boxes, rolls of packing tape, bubble wrap to protect fragile items, packing paper, tape dispenser, etc. Moving boxes can range anywhere from small, medium, large, and extra large to various size wardrobe, kitchen, and dish boxes.
It is important to keep these moving tips handy to remember on your big moving day. The major part of any move that you are about to make will be spent packing and unpacking valuable possessions. Make a checklist or a moving book of things that you need to do including notifying your post office, school, family doctors, etc. of your move. In this book you can also after packing each box and placing a number on it, write what each of these numbers pertain to. Your moving can be so much easier if you are organized. You will feel so much better as you check off each task, knowing that everything checked is completed. Make sure that everything that you have packed is secured. Finally, keep moving day a safe day.
